The ingredients needed to make Low Calorie Warabi Mochi for Dieters Made with 2 Ingredients:

  1. Get 4 tbsp Katakuriko
  2. Get 300 ml Water

Steps to make Low Calorie Warabi Mochi for Dieters Made with 2 Ingredients:

  1. Put the ingredients in a saucepan and mix continuously over medium heat. When the mixture has become transparent, remove it from the heat and let it chill in ice water.
  2. Break it into bite-sized pieces between your thumb and index finger.
  3. Top with kinako powder and kuromitsu to finish.
